The Value of Aneurysm Volume and Myocardial Strain Rate for Evaluating Cardiac Function of Ischemia‐Related Left Ventricular Aneurysm in a Rabbit Model Using Real Time Three‐Dimensional Echocardiographic Imaging Combined with Speckle Tracking Imaging

Abstract: LVA volume/LVEDV provided a sensitive indicator reflecting cardiac function with LVA. Measurement of various parameters using RT-3DE might be a useful means to evaluate cardiac function after LVA formation.
